The Nike SB Dunk Low Showcases another Combination of Green and Royal Hues

Despite Nike extensively promoting the Dunk Low silhouette, its skateboard-oriented counterpart designed for skating continues to gain traction without losing momentum. Both collaborative ventures and releases exclusive to skate shops remain highly sought after, particularly because of the distinctive fat-tongued design and the impressive color-blocking, which has become a hallmark of Nike SB.

Similar to a previously unveiled SB Dunk in late 2023, this upcoming release features a construction using luxurious suedes throughout, relying on a refreshed color-blocking scheme for its visual impact. Royal Blue and Malachite Green come together on the upper, with the former serving as the primary layer and the latter accentuating the Swoosh logos and heel tab. Nike incorporates a neutral Phantom shade on the overlay, while the white midsole and gum outsole contribute to the timeless aesthetic of a classic skate shoe.

With the standard SB Dunk models now priced at $115 for 2024, anticipate this elevated price point when the shoes become available in skate shops and, hopefully, on Nike SNKRS.
